Cocos2d-x 的onEnter() 和 onEnterTransitionDidFinish() 场景延时跳转
来源:互联网 发布:中国移动送话费软件 编辑:程序博客网 时间:2024/05/16 09:55
onEnter() 是在进入场景的一瞬间就开始执行了。
onEnterTransitionDidFinish() 是在完全进入场景后开始执行的。
因为在弄场景的延时跳转,游戏一开始显示公司Logo,然后显示游戏场景界面。
在第一个场景welcomScene的 onEnter() 开始场景跳转的事件。 延时3秒。
- void WelcomScene::onEnter()
- {
- //跳转场景
- CCScene* pScene=InverseWarsScene::scene();
- CCDirector::sharedDirector()->replaceScene(CCTransitionFade::create(3,pScene));
- }
这里要用到播放背景音乐,背景音乐可以在一开始进入场景 onEnter() 时候进行预加载,然后在完全进入场景 onEnterTransitionDidFinish() 的时候开始播放音乐。
- void InverseWarsScene::onEnter()
- {
- //在刚进入界面的时候预加载背景音乐,在inverseWarsScene场景开始播放音乐
- CocosDenshion::SimpleAudioEngine::sharedEngine()-> preloadBackgroundMusic("Audio/Background/ChmpSlct_BlindPick.mp3");
- }
- //在完全进入这个场景后开始执行的事件
- void InverseWarsScene::onEnterTransitionDidFinish()
- {
- //完全进入场景后开始播放音乐
- CocosDenshion::SimpleAudioEngine::sharedEngine()->playBackgroundMusic("Audio/Background/ChmpSlct_BlindPick.mp3");
- }
0 0
- Cocos2d-x 的onEnter() 和 onEnterTransitionDidFinish() 场景延时跳转
- Cocos2d-x 的onEnter() 和 onEnterTransitionDidFinish() 场景延时跳转
- Cocos2d-x 3.2 onEnter与onEnterTransitionDidFinish的区别
- Cocos2d-x 3.2 onEnter与onEnterTransitionDidFinish的区别
- Cocos2d-x之onEnter()、onEnterTransitionDidFinish()、onExit()、onExitTransitionDidStart()
- cocos2dx场景切换中init、onEnter、onEnterTransitionDidFinish的调用顺序
- cocos2dx场景切换中init、onEnter、onEnterTransitionDidFinish的调用
- cocos2dx场景切换中init、onEnter、onEnterTransitionDidFinish的调用顺序
- cocos2dx场景切换中init、onEnter、onEnterTransitionDidFinish的调用顺序
- cocos2dx场景切换中init、onEnter、onEnterTransitionDidFinish的调用顺序
- cocos2dx场景切换中init、onEnter、onEnterTransitionDidFinish的调用顺序
- cocos2dx场景切换中init、onEnter、onEnterTransitionDidFinish的调用顺序
- cocos2dx场景切换中init、onEnter、onEnterTransitionDidFinish的调用顺序
- cocos2d-x 自定义场景和场景跳转
- cocos2d-x 自定义场景和场景跳转
- Cocos2d-x 3.0-Director和场景跳转
- cocos2d-x学习之onEnter和init的区别
- [Cocos2d-x] init()和onEnter()方法的区别
- Android使用SimpleAdapter更新ListView里面的Drawable元素
- Oracle SQL优化规则详解
- 《高效学习OpenGL》之Hello OpenGl
- 马化腾:移动互联网的未来空间
- 背景随高度变化
- Cocos2d-x 的onEnter() 和 onEnterTransitionDidFinish() 场景延时跳转
- 在iOS开发中使用FMDB
- MFC中CRect和opencv中CvRect的区别
- ���Ա���1
- ���Ա���2
- ���Ա���3
- 马蹄声袭来,犹见青衣织桃花伞,断送了情执
- iPhone开发之显示WiFi提示
- 查询ip地址